The Organ of St. Pankratius-Kirche
Rieger-Orgelbau 2015
SPECIFICATION
Manual 1. HAUPTWERK
Principal 16
Principal 8
Viola di Gamba 8
Flûte harmonique 8
Gedeckt 8
Dulciana 8
Octave 4
Rohrflöte 4
Quinte 2 2/3
Octave 2
Groß Mixtur V 2
Mixtur IV 1 1/3
Cornet (from f º) V 8
Tuba profunda 16
Trompete 8
Euphonium 8 (Free Reed)
Manual 2. RÜCKPOSITIV
Principal 8
Lieblich Gedeckt 8
Salicional 8
Octave 4
Flauto d'amore 4
Nasat 2 2/3
Flautino 2
Terz 1 3/5
Quinte 1 1/3
Mixtur III 1
Clarinette 8
Tremulant
Manual 3. SCHWELLWERK
Bordun 16
Diapason 8
Flûte traversière 8
Nachthorn 8
Gambe 8
Vox coelestis 8
Quintatön 8
Fugara 4
Flûte octaviante
Quintflöte 2 2/3
Piccolo 2
Hornterz 1 3/5
Progression II-V 2
Basson 16
Trompette harmonique 8
Basson-Hautbois 8
Clairon 4
Tremulant
PEDAL
Kontraviolon 32 (Acoustic)
Kontrabaß 16
Salicetbaß 16
Subbaß 16
Quintbaß 10 2/3
Octavbaß 8
Violoncello 8
Flötenbaß 8
Octave 4
Bombarde 16
Posaune 16
Trompete 8
Klarine 4
Couplers
II/I, III/II, III/I
I/Ped, II/Ped, III/Ped
III16', III4'
III/II16', III/II4', III/I16', III/I4'
